This song is probably talking about religion.
"There'll be no angels gracing these lines
Just these stark words I find" as shown in the great dissappointment, Davey's probably atheist, so this is his way of saying that life's lines are graced, not with angels, but with death. You find the truth at the end, "stark words", But find no happiness,"No angels gracing these lines".

"I cannot leave here, I cannot stay"
I can't stand the way the world is, but I can't let go of my life.
"Forever haunted, more than afraid"
Being faced with the cruelty of the world and the nothingness of death terrifies me to no end. I cannot let go.
"Asphyxiate on words I would say"
I can't so easily pretend I'm not scared, I can't say what I normally would so quickly or without thought.
"Forever darkened
Now as I turn blue"
I am burdened with my depression as I try to move on. I fall into sadness as I try to escape the darkness, to turn me depressed.
"There are no flowers
No not this time"
Life has nothing for me, I have nothing to keep me.
"There'll be no angels
Gracing the lines"
There's no heaven, nothing for me in death.
"Just these stark words I find"
I only see indecision, I can't decide life or death.
"I'd show a smile
But I'm too weak"
I can't lie about my pain anymore, the burden is to hard to bear.
"I'd share with you
Could I only speak
Just how much this hurts me"
I can't speak of my pain; I can't comprehend my own pain, let alone tell you. I know, however, that this pain is too much to bear.

Basically, the point is that the song seems to me like it's about suicide.
